1. Start with Churn Analysis: Find Out Who’s Leaving (Customer Churn in Payments)
Definition:
Churn rate is the percentage of users who stop transacting in a set period.
Not every customer who stops using your payment service is “lost” for the same reason. Start by calculating your churn rate using the formula:Churn Rate = (Number of users lost during period) / (Total users at start of period) * 100
How to do it:
- Pull user IDs and their last transaction dates from your database (e.g., via SQL).
- Filter for those with no activity in the last 90 days (or whatever makes sense for your business model).
- Compare the group that left to those who stayed, segmenting by account type (personal, merchant) or transaction volume.
Pro tip:
Segment users by account type (personal, merchant) or transaction volume. Sometimes the biggest churners are small but noisy accounts.
Example:
A European payment app (2023, internal case study) noticed churn among new merchants spiked after their first three failed chargebacks. Adding targeted support emails after a disputed transaction dropped early churn by 14% in one quarter.
Limitation:
Churn analysis can miss “silent churners” who log in but don’t transact—see section 11.
2. Map the Customer Journey: Where Are Drop-Offs Happening? (Journey Mapping for Payments)
Definition:
Customer journey mapping is a framework for visualizing every step a user takes, from sign-up to support.
It’s easy to assume users leave after a bad experience, but where? Journey mapping visualizes every step—sign-up, funding wallets, making a payment, customer support calls.
How to do it:
- Sketch out major steps with your product team using frameworks like the Service Blueprint or CJM (Customer Journey Map).
- Overlay event data (like page views, button clicks, time spent) from your analytics platform.
- Look for sharp drops in activity at specific steps.
Gotcha:
Be wary of “happy paths”—real users don’t always act logically or in the order you expect.
Tool tip:
Heatmap tools like Hotjar, Mixpanel, or even basic SQL queries for “last action taken” can be eye-opening.
Implementation Example:
If you see a 30% drop-off after the KYC upload step, consider simplifying document requirements or adding tooltips.

4. Combine Quant and Qual: Match Transaction Data to Feedback (Mixed Methods in Payments Research)
Definition:
Mixed-methods research combines quantitative (transaction logs) and qualitative (user feedback) data.
You’ll get a richer picture if you connect what users do with what they say.
How to do it:
- Link survey responses (from Zigpoll, Typeform, etc.) to user IDs in your analytics database.
- Analyze transaction patterns before and after feedback using cohort analysis.
Example:
One team found users complaining about “slow transfers” had, on average, 2.4x more failed top-ups in the month before quitting (2023, fintech case study).
Limitation:
Privacy rules (e.g., GDPR) mean you have to anonymize data or secure special permissions.
5. Schedule Exit Interviews for Closed Accounts (Qualitative Interviews in Payments)
FAQ:
How do I get users to agree to an exit interview?
Offer a small incentive (e.g., $10 Amazon voucher) and keep the interview under 15 minutes.
Nothing beats hearing straight from the source. Reach out to users within a week of closing their accounts. Even a 10-minute call or chat can yield insights you’d never spot in logs.
How to organize:
- Use CRM tools to flag recently closed accounts.
- Offer an incentive for their time.
- Use a script, but stay open to tangents.
Downside:
You’ll get selection bias—people with the strongest feelings (good or bad) are more likely to reply.
6. A/B Test Retention Features—And Track Who Stays (A/B Testing for Payment Retention)
Definition:
A/B testing is a controlled experiment comparing two variants to measure impact.
Want to know if a new onboarding tip or fee reduction works? A/B testing gives you a controlled way to see what actually impacts retention.
Implementation Steps:
- Randomly assign new users to control and test groups.
- Roll out the new feature (e.g., onboarding tip) to the test group only.
- Track retention and engagement over 30+ days.
Example:
A payment processor tested sending “Welcome, here’s how to avoid fees” emails to half their new users. That group had 12% higher retention after 30 days (2023, internal data).
Caveat:
Statistical significance takes time and volume—if your user base is small, results may not be reliable.
Comparison Table: Survey vs. A/B Test
| Feature | Surveys | A/B Test |
|---|---|---|
| Feedback type | Self-reported | Behavioral |
| Time to run | Days | Weeks+ |
| Sample needed | 100+ | 1,000+ (ideally) |
| Best for | Reasons, opinions | Feature impact |
7. Leverage Support Ticket Analysis: Find Hidden Friction (Support Analytics in Payments)
Every time a user contacts support, that’s a mini user research session. Analyze support tickets (with text analysis or just tags) to spot recurring themes.
How:
- Export ticket summaries from Zendesk, Intercom, or your CRM.
- Use keyword searches for “refund”, “declined”, “can’t login”.
Example:
A 2024 Forrester report found that payment apps resolving issues in under 1 hour retained 19% more users than those taking 24 hours or longer.
Limitation:
Support data may miss users who churn without ever contacting support.
8. Observe Real Users (with Consent) in Usability Sessions (Usability Testing for Payment Apps)
Sometimes, watch and learn. Invite users (especially those who’ve lapsed or complained) to try your app—on Zoom, or in a lab.
How to run:
- Ask them to complete a real task (e.g., send $10 to a friend).
- Record where they get stuck.
- Don’t intervene; just watch.
Tip:
Recruit a mix of new and experienced users. Their struggles can be very different.
Limitation:
Lab settings may not reflect real-world distractions or device issues.
9. Set Up Early Warning Alerts: Watch for Retention Predictors (Predictive Analytics for Churn)
Don’t wait for churn. Find patterns—like users who stop using a card for 14 days, or get multiple transaction declines.
How to implement:
- Identify key predictors in your data (e.g., no logins for 2 weeks, 3+ failed transactions).
- Trigger emails or app notifications (“Is everything okay?”) using automation tools.
One team’s result:
A payments start-up cut churn by 7% by reaching out to merchants after the first week of inactivity (2023, industry report).

11. Track “Silent Churn”: Dormant Accounts Still Logging In (Detecting Silent Churn in Payments)
Definition:
Silent churners are users who log in but don’t transact.
Not every at-risk user disappears. Some log in, check balances, but don’t transact. These “silent churners” are easy to miss in standard churn metrics.
Steps:
- Segment users with no transactions but recent logins.
- Use Zigpoll or in-app nudges: “Need help making your next payment?”
Example:
After finding 8,000 “silent churners”, a payment app ran a campaign offering free instant transfers. 17% reactivated within the month (2023, internal data).

13. Use Cohort Analysis to Spot Patterns Over Time (Cohort Analysis for Payment Retention)
Definition:
Cohort analysis groups users by signup date to track retention patterns.
Group users by the month or week they joined. Track how each cohort behaves—do users from December 2023 stick around longer than those from January 2024?
How-to:
- In SQL or your BI tool, create a cohort column based on signup date.
- Graph retention curves to compare.
What to look for:
If one month’s users churn faster, what changed? New fees, a system bug, or a marketing campaign that attracted the wrong audience?

15. Close the Loop: Test Changes and Measure Again (Iterative Retention Improvement in Payments)
User research is cyclical. After making changes (new FAQ, improved onboarding), check if retention metrics move.
How:
- Set your baseline before launching changes.
- Compare churn rate and engagement over 1-3 months after rollout.
Caveat:
External events (holidays, new regulations) can muddy the results. Always annotate big events in your data timeline.
